Common Fort Hood Emergencies
Sparks or arcing from outlets, switches, or panels
Burning smell or smoke from electrical sources
Repeated circuit breaker trips refusing to reset
Visible exposed, damaged, or buzzing wires
Electrical shocks when touching appliances or fixtures
Water contact with live electrical components
Local Weather Risks in Fort Hood
Triggers
- Lightning strikes causing surges and fires - High winds downing power lines - Heavy rains or flooding around panels and meters - Extreme heat overloading circuits
Seasonal Risks
In Central Texas areas like Fort Hood, spikes occur during hot summers with high AC loads and thunderstorms, plus winter freezes stressing heating systems. Emergencies often follow severe weather patterns.
Disaster Scenarios
After storms or floods: Never approach downed lines – they can energize ground. Post-freeze thaws may reveal hidden wire damage. Call pros to inspect safely.

Emergency Prevention Tips
- ✓ Use surge protectors for electronics and appliances.
- ✓ Test GFCI outlets monthly by pressing the test button.
- ✓ Never overload circuits or daisy-chain extension cords.
- ✓ Keep panel areas clear of storage and flammables.
- ✓ Schedule yearly inspections with qualified pros.
